The Columbus Athletic Supply was a professional basketball team in Columbus, Ohio. It was one of the founding teams in the National Basketball League, which formed in 1937. In 1949, this league joined with the Basketball Association of America to form the National Basketball Association.
The Columbus Athletic Supply played for just one season (1937-1938). During the season, the team finished last in the the National Basketball League
